Before you convert HEIC to DCM
HEIC can carry an alpha channel and DCM cannot. Transparent areas are composited onto a solid background during conversion, so pick that background colour deliberately: white is the default, and it is rarely the right choice for a logo that will sit on a dark page. DCM is lossless, so nothing further is discarded during conversion. What it cannot do is restore detail that HEIC compression already removed, and the output file will usually be considerably larger.
